Proclaiming Your Hope

1 Peter 3:13-17 (NASB)
13  Who is there to harm you if you prove zealous for what is good?
14  But even if you should suffer for the sake of righteousness, you are blessed. AND DO NOT FEAR THEIRINTIMIDATION, AND DO NOT BE TROUBLED,
15  but sanctify Christ as Lord in your hearts, always being ready to make a defense to everyone who asks you to give an account for the hope that is in you, yet with gentleness and reverence;
16  and keep a good conscience so that in the thing in which you are slandered, those who revile your good behavior in Christ will be put to shame.
17  For it is better, if God should will it so, that you suffer for doing what is right rather than for doing what is wrong.

1.     Share Hope In Christ Whenever You Can

2.     Share Hope With Gentleness, Reverence, & A Good Conscience

3.     Share Hope Even While Suffering For Doing Good  

1 Peter 3:18-22 (NASB)
18  For Christ also died for sins once for all, the just for the unjust, so that He might bring us to God, having been put to death in the flesh, but made alive in the spirit;
19  in which also He went and made proclamation to the spirits now in prison,
20  who once were disobedient, when the patience of God kept waiting in the days of Noah, during the construction of the ark, in which a few, that is, eight persons, were brought safely through the water.
21  Corresponding to that, baptism now saves you—not the removal of dirt from the flesh, but an appeal to God for a good conscience—through the resurrection of Jesus Christ,
22  who is at the right hand of God, having gone into heaven, after angels and authorities and powers had been subjected to Him.

4.     Share Why Hope In Christ Is Well Founded
